Jump to content

Software Categories Wikipedia

From WarhammerWorkshop
Revision as of 16:48, 27 October 2025 by VidaCordeaux077 (talk | contribs) (Created page with "<br><br><br>Breakage changes are indicated by increasing the Major count (high-pitched risk); new, non-breakage features increase the venial numerate (culture medium risk); and wholly early non-breakage changes increase the piece routine (last risk). The comportment of a pre-passing shred (-alpha, -beta) indicates real risk, as does a major identification number of nada (0.y.z), which is put-upon to suggest a work-in-procession that whitethorn take whatsoever tier of pos...")
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)




Breakage changes are indicated by increasing the Major count (high-pitched risk); new, non-breakage features increase the venial numerate (culture medium risk); and wholly early non-breakage changes increase the piece routine (last risk). The comportment of a pre-passing shred (-alpha, -beta) indicates real risk, as does a major identification number of nada (0.y.z), which is put-upon to suggest a work-in-procession that whitethorn take whatsoever tier of possibly break changes (highest risk). As an deterrent example of inferring compatibility from a SemVer version, software which relies on version 2.1.5 of an API is compatible with variation 2.2.3, just non needs with 3.2.4.
Again, in these examples, the definition of what constitutes a "major" as opposed to a "minor" switch is alone immanent and up to the author, as is what defines a "build", or how a "revision" differs from a "minor" switch. They appropriate package to be silent in price of those categories, as an alternative of the particularities of for FREE RUSSIAN PORN each one software. The industriousness expanded greatly with the lift of the personal estimator ("PC") in the mid-1970s, which brought screen background computing to the role proletarian for the foremost clip. In the undermentioned years, it also created a growth grocery for games, applications, and utilities. DOS, Microsoft's low gear in operation system product, was the dominant in operation system of rules at the clock time.
This means, for instance, that copyleft licenses loosely proscribe others to sum additional requirements to the package (though a express Set of secure added requirements tail end be allowed) and take qualification informant codification usable. This shields the program, and its limited versions, from some of the unwashed ways of fashioning a programme proprietary. A different approach shot is to employ the John R. Major and nipper Numbers along with an alphanumerical string denoting the turn type, e.g. "alpha" (a), "beta" (b), or "release candidate" (rc). A software program free gear exploitation this overture mightiness bet corresponding 0.5, 0.6, 0.7, 0.8, 0.9 → 1.0b1, 1.0b2 (with more or less fixes), 1.0b3 (with More fixes) → 1.0rc1 (if it is static enough), 1.0rc2 (if to a greater extent bugs are found) → 1.0. It is a vulgar practise in this dodging to lock in prohibited Modern features and breakage changes during the vent nominee phases and, for close to teams, even out betas are secured go through to hemipteron fixes only, to secure convergence on the aim acquittance. Semantic versioning (aka SemVer)[1] is a widely adopted interpretation scheme[7] that encodes a version by a three-start out variant add up (Major.Fry.Patch), an optional pre-exit tag, and an optional body-build meta chase.
Noncopylefted disembarrass software program comes from the author with permission to redistribute qualify and append certify restrictions.
Call for for software system was created by universities, the government, and businesses. Others were through on a transaction basis, and former firms so much as Computer Sciences Corporation (founded in 1959) started to get. Former influential or distinctive computer software companies begun in the former 1960s included Ripe Computing machine Techniques, Automatonlike Data Processing, Applied Information Research, and Information processing Universal.[3][4] The computer/ironware makers started bundling operating systems, systems software and programing environments with their machines. Developers Crataegus laevigata select to leap multiple pocket-sized versions at a time to betoken that important features rich person been added, simply are non decent to guarantee incrementing a John Major rendering number; for example, Cyberspace Internet Explorer 5 from 5.1 to 5.5 or Adobe brick Photoshop 5 to 5.5. This Crataegus laevigata be through with to emphasize the measure of the rising slope to the software exploiter or, as in Adobe's case, to symbolize a spill midway betwixt Major versions (although levels of sequence-based versioning are non inevitably express to a individual digit, as in Liquidizer reading 2.91 or Minecraft Coffee Version start from 1.7.10). Copylefted software is loose software whose statistical distribution damage ascertain that completely copies of all versions hold More or to a lesser extent the Saami statistical distribution price.